MINI SAUSAGE BUNDLES

Thanks to these hors d'oeuvres, you can cut calories, fat and cleanup by keeping the deep fryer at bay. Our Test Kitchen filled the mouthwatering appetizers with savory turkey sausage, garlic and onion before baking them in the oven to a golden brown.-Taste of Home Test Kitchen

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 425°. In a large skillet, cook and crumble sausage with onion, red pepper and garlic over medium-high heat until no longer pink, 4-6 minutes. Stir in cheese; cool slightly. , Place one sheet of phyllo dough on a work surface; spritz with cooking spray. Layer with two additional phyllo sheets, spritzing each layer. (Keep remaining phyllo covered with plastic wrap and a damp towel to prevent it from drying out.) Cut phyllo crosswise into three strips (about 4-1/2-in. wide)., Place a rounded tablespoon sausage mixture near the end of each strip. Fold end of strip over filling, then fold in sides and roll up. Place on an ungreased baking sheet, seam side down. Repeat with remaining phyllo and filling., Bake until lightly browned, 8-10 minutes. If desired, tie bundles with chives. Serve warm.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 74 calories, Fat 3g fat (1g saturated fat), Cholesterol 12mg cholesterol, Sodium 154mg sodium, Carbohydrate 7g carbohydrate (1g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 4g protein. Diabetic Exchanges

1/2 pound turkey Italian sausage links, casings removed
1 small onion, finely chopped
1/4 cup finely chopped sweet red pepper
1 garlic clove, minced
1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ese
12 sheets phyllo dough (14x9-inch size)
Cooking spray
12 whole chives, optional

Steps:

  • Place sausage in a large, deep skillet; cook over medium-high heat until evenly brown, about 10 minutes. Remove sausage from the skillet and let drain on paper towels. Combine melted margarine with the sausage drippings until there is 1 cup of drippings and margarine combined.
  • Cook and stir onion and celery in the margarine-dripping mixture in the same skillet over medium heat until onion is tender but not browned, about 10 minutes . Stir in about 1/3 of the bread cubes. Pour onion mixture into a large bowl and stir in remaining bread cubes, sausage, poultry seasoning, and pepper. Watch your hands, it's hot. Mix well. This stuffing is ready for baking.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 325.1 calories, Carbohydrate 13.5 g, Cholesterol 27 mg, Fat 26.9 g, Fiber 1 g, Protein 6.9 g, SaturatedFat 7.5 g, Sodium 512.3 mg, Sugar 1.8 g

1 pound breakfast sausage
¾ cup margarine, melted
¾ cup finely diced onion
1 ½ cups chopped celery
8 cups soft bread cubes, divided
3 teaspoons poultry seasoning
¼ teaspoon 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. In a large skillet, cook sausage over medium heat 4-6 minutes or until no longer pink, breaking into crumbles; drain. Add sauerkraut, peppers and onion; cook and stir 8-10 minutes longer or until vegetables are tender., Spoon meat mixture onto bun bottoms; place cheese over meat. Replace tops. Place on a baking sheet. Bake 4-6 minutes or until cheese is melted.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 494 calories, Fat 24g fat (7g saturated fat), Cholesterol 46mg cholesterol, Sodium 1042mg sodium, Carbohydrate 52g carbohydrate (6g sugars, Fiber 3g fiber), Protein 20g protein.

1 pound bulk spicy pork sausage
1-1/2 cups sauerkraut, rinsed and well drained
2 medium green and/or sweet yellow peppers, chopped
1 medium onion, chopped
8 pretzel or regular hamburger buns, split
8 slices provolone cheese

Steps:

  • Uncase and separate sausage.
  • Brown sausage in a skillet over medium-high heat.
  • Drain off excess drippings.
  • Combine cheese, chillies, green onions and sausage in a medium bowl.
  • Spoon 1 round teaspoon of sausage mixture near 1 corner of wonton wrapper.
  • Brush opposite corner with water.
  • Roll up "jelly roll" style.
  • Moisten ends of roll with water.
  • Bring ends together to make a "bundle" overlapping slightly and pressing firmly.
  • Repeat with remaining filling and wrappers.
  • Heat deep fryer to about 365.
  • Fry bundles a few at a time for about 2 minutes or until golden brown.
  • Drain on paper towel and serve.
  • **Bundles may also be frozen and reheated in the oven.**.

500 g hot Italian pork sausage
2 cups shredded monterey jack cheese
2 cans chopped green chilies
4 tablespoons finely chopped green onions
75 wonton wrappers
water

Steps:

  • Reserve bacon fat& saute onion until tender in the fat.
  • Stir in sauerkraut, sausage, brown sugar, garlic salt, caraway and pepper.
  • Cook& stir 5 minutes.
  • Remove from heat; add bacon.
  • Set aside to cool.
  • In a bowl, combine hot roll mix& one egg, water and butter& mix to form soft dough.
  • Turn onto a floured surface; knead until smooth& elastic- about 5 minutes.
  • Cover dough& let stand 10 minutes.
  • Divide dough into 16 pieces.
  • On a floured surface, roll each piece into a 4" circle.
  • Top each circle w/ approx.
  • 1/4 c.
  • filling.
  • Fold dough around filling, forming a ball; pinch the edges to seal.
  • Place seam side down on greased cookie sheets.
  • Cover w/ towels& set in warm place to rise for 30 minutes.
  • Beat remaining egg; brush over bundles.
  • Sprinkle with sesame or poppy seeds.
  • Bake@ 350 for 15-20 minutes, or until golden brown.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 218.7, Fat 11.1, SaturatedFat 3.8, Cholesterol 40.2, Sodium 729.8, Carbohydrate 23.9, Fiber 1.7, Sugar 6.2, Protein 5.9

8 slices bacon, cooked & crumbled
1 cup chopped onion
16 ounces sauerkraut, drained
1/2 lb fully cooked smoked kielbasa or 1/2 lb Polish sausage, coarsely chopped
2 tablespoons brown sugar
1/2 teaspoon garlic salt
1/4 teaspoon caraway seed (optional)
1/8 teaspoon black pepper
16 ounces hot roll mix
2 eggs
1 cup water (120-130*)
2 tablespoons butter or 2 tablespoons margarine, softened
sesame or poppy seed

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400°. In a large skillet, heat butter over medium heat. Add bratwurst and onion; cook and stir until onion is tender, 8-10 minutes. Stir in sauerkraut; cool slightly., In a small bowl, mix sour cream, mustard and 1/2 teaspoon caraway seeds. Unfold one sheet of puff pastry. Spread with 1/3 cup sour cream mixture to within 1/2 in. of edges. Spoon 2-1/2 cups sausage mixture down center of pastry; sprinkle with 1/2 cup each Muenster and cheddar cheeses., Lightly brush edges of pastry with water; bring edges together, pinching to seal. Transfer to an ungreased baking sheet, seam side down; pinch ends and fold under. Repeat with remaining ingredients., Brush tops with water; sprinkle with remaining caraway seeds. Cut slits in pastry. Bake until golden brown, 25-30 minutes. Let stand 10 minutes before slicing.

Nutrition Facts :

1 tablespoon butter
5 fully cooked bratwurst links (about 1-1/4 pounds), chopped
1 medium onion, chopped
1 can (14 ounces) sauerkraut, rinsed and well-drained
1/2 cup sour cream
3 tablespoons Dijon mustard
2-1/2 teaspoons caraway seeds, divided
1 package (17.3 ounces) frozen puff pastry, thawed
1 cup shredded Muenster cheese
1 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ese
